Unlocking Creativity with Cricut Design Space’s “Make It Now” Projects
One of the greatest joys of owning a smart cutting machine like a Cricut is the endless possibility it offers for crafting, especially when it comes to projects that look complex but are incredibly simple to execute. The beautiful design for these 3D snowflake ornaments comes directly from the extensive library of images within Cricut Design Space. What’s even better? It’s featured as a “Make It Now” project!
If you’re new to Cricut or looking for quick, satisfying projects, “Make It Now” is a game-changer. These pre-designed projects are a dream come true because all the hard work of designing and formatting is already done for you. The template is perfectly prepared, ensuring precise cuts and seamless assembly. It’s as straightforward as browsing the options, finding a project that sparks your interest, and hitting the “Make It” button. Cricut Design Space guides you through the process, from selecting your materials to loading your mat, making it an ideal feature for both beginners and experienced crafters alike.
While the “Make It Now” feature streamlines the process, Cricut also empowers you with customization options. Should you wish to personalize your project, perhaps by altering the size of your snowflakes or experimenting with different layers, you can easily do so by selecting the ‘Customize’ button. This opens the design within the canvas, allowing you to unlock elements, resize, duplicate, or even add your own creative flair. This flexibility means you can adapt any “Make It Now” project to perfectly suit your vision and decorative needs, ensuring your finished piece is truly unique.

Gather Your Supplies: Materials for Your Snowflake Masterpiece
To embark on this delightful crafting journey, you’ll need just a few essential supplies. The beauty of these 3D snowflakes lies in their simplicity and the stunning impact they create with minimal materials. For my particular project, I opted for crisp white and vibrant turquoise cardstock, which created a beautiful contrast and a classic winter feel. However, don’t limit your imagination! Consider experimenting with various shades of blue, silver, gold, icy pastels, or even glitter cardstock for an extra touch of sparkle. The weight of your cardstock (typically 65-100 lb) will influence the rigidity and durability of your finished ornaments, so choose wisely based on your desired outcome.
The star of the show for cutting these intricate designs is, of course, a reliable cutting machine. I used my Cricut Explore Air 2, which effortlessly handles the precise cuts required for these snowflake templates. Its accuracy ensures that each piece fits together perfectly, making the assembly process a breeze. If you have another Cricut model or a similar electronic cutting machine, it will likely work just as well.
I cut out various sizes, discovering that the 4-inch snowflakes were absolutely perfect for adorning my Christmas tree, offering a delicate yet noticeable presence. But why stop there? Imagine the dramatic impact of oversized snowflakes! I’m already envisioning cutting some colossal versions, perhaps 10 or 12 inches across, to create a stunning focal point on a mantlepiece or as part of a festive tablescape. The possibilities are truly endless, limited only by the size of your cutting mat and your imagination. This flexibility allows you to customize your decor to any space and aesthetic.
Beyond the cardstock and your cutting machine, you’ll also need a glue gun. A hot glue gun is my preferred adhesive for these ornaments because it provides a strong, instant bond, preventing the pieces from wiggling or flattening during assembly. Make sure to have extra glue sticks on hand!
Step-by-Step Assembly: Bringing Your Snowflakes to Life
Once your Cricut has worked its magic and precisely cut out all your snowflake templates, it’s time for the gratifying process of assembly. This is where the flat pieces transform into beautiful, dimensional ornaments. Each snowflake template is designed with specific cut-out notches that are crucial for creating the 3D effect. You’ll intuitively see what I mean as soon as you have the cut pieces in your hand.
- Prepare Your Pieces: Carefully remove the cut snowflake pieces from your cutting mat. If you’ve chosen multiple colors or sizes, keep them organized to make assembly smoother. Each 3D snowflake typically consists of two identical cutouts.
- Interlock the Notches: Take two identical snowflake pieces. You’ll notice that each piece has a slit cut from one edge towards the center. To create the 3D effect, gently slide one snowflake onto the other by interlocking these notches. One piece will slide down from the top, and the other will slide up from the bottom, meeting in the middle. This creates a cross shape and the initial dimension of your snowflake.
- Secure with Glue: While the interlocking notches provide a basic structure, the pieces can sometimes wiggle or become flat over time. To ensure your 3D snowflakes maintain their beautiful shape, I highly recommend using a glue gun. Apply a small bead of hot glue to the back of the interlocking connection points. Press firmly for a few seconds until the glue sets. The key is to apply the glue as discreetly as possible, aiming for the back or inner seams of the connection to keep your ornaments looking pristine. Work quickly as hot glue dries fast!
- Add a Hanging Loop: For tree ornaments, don’t forget the hanging mechanism! Once your snowflake is securely assembled, cut a piece of string, ribbon, or baker’s twine about 6-8 inches long. Form a loop and tie the ends together. Use a small dot of hot glue to attach the tied end to one of the top points or a central back point of your snowflake. This ensures it hangs beautifully on your tree.
- Optional Embellishments: To add an extra touch of sparkle, consider applying a thin layer of craft glue and sprinkling fine glitter onto the snowflake edges or points. You can also attach small self-adhesive rhinestones or use metallic markers to highlight certain details.
Beyond the Tree: Creative Display Ideas for Your 3D Snowflakes
While these 3D snowflake ornaments are undoubtedly stunning on a Christmas tree, their versatility extends far beyond that. Don’t limit your creativity! Here are some inspiring ways to incorporate your handmade snowflakes into your holiday decor:
- Mantlepiece Marvel: As mentioned, larger 10-12 inch snowflakes create a striking display on a mantle. Arrange them alongside twinkling fairy lights, pinecones, and evergreen garlands for a cozy, rustic, yet elegant look.
- Window Wonderland: Hang various sizes of snowflakes from curtain rods or directly onto windows with fishing line for a magical, floating effect. When light hits them, they cast beautiful shadows and add a serene winter ambiance.
- Garland Glamour: String multiple snowflakes together with ribbon or twine to create a captivating garland for stair banisters, doorways, or above a fireplace. Mix in some fairy lights for added enchantment.
- Gift Toppers with a Personal Touch: Attach a small 3D snowflake to the top of a wrapped gift instead of a traditional bow. It adds an extra layer of thoughtfulness and can double as a small keepsake for the recipient.
- Table Centerpieces: Arrange several snowflakes of different sizes around a candle or vase of winter greenery for an elegant holiday centerpiece.
- Party Decorations: If you’re hosting a winter-themed party, these snowflakes make fantastic ceiling decorations or wall hangings, transforming your space into a snowy wonderland.
- Mobile Magic: Create a delicate mobile by suspending snowflakes at varying heights from a hanger or branch, perfect for a nursery or a quiet corner.
